Earthquake Impact Analyst

An Earthquake Impact Analyst assesses the effects of seismic events on structures and infrastructure to minimize damage and protect lives.

Seismic Risk Assessor

A Seismic Risk Assessor evaluates the likelihood and potential impact of earthquakes on buildings, bridges, and other structures.

Disaster Recovery Specialist

A Disaster Recovery Specialist develops plans and strategies to recover from earthquakes and other natural disasters efficiently.

Emergency Response Coordinator

An Emergency Response Coordinator coordinates and manages emergency response efforts during and after earthquakes to ensure effective disaster relief.

Geotechnical Engineer

A Geotechnical Engineer studies soil and rock behavior to design foundations and structures that can withstand seismic forces from earthquakes.
